You can call your dealer to have keys cut if you are unable to locate your car keys. They will be able to identify your specific key by its VIN and cut a replacement quickly. They can also program your new key to wipe the old one from your car's system, meaning that if a burglar finds it, they are unable to use it to drive your car.

A mobile locksmith for automotive can also come to your home and create a new key for you. The locksmith will require the year and model of your vehicle, as well proof that you are the owner (such as an image of your registration). This is more expensive but faster than going through the dealer.
